mirror of
https://codeberg.org/forgejo/forgejo.git
synced 2024-12-23 20:24:08 +01:00
c37ec66ee2
New CSS linter which is much more powerfull than the previous one. Configuration is default but I had to remove a few rules that were throwing too many or weird errors. More importantly, the linter will exit with code 1 on errors so now our build will fail if the CSS linter fails which should eliminate linter errors being introduced without notice.
149 lines
2.9 KiB
Text
149 lines
2.9 KiB
Text
.user {
|
|
&:not(.icon) {
|
|
padding-top: 15px;
|
|
}
|
|
|
|
&.profile {
|
|
.ui.card {
|
|
.username {
|
|
display: block;
|
|
}
|
|
|
|
.extra.content {
|
|
padding: 0;
|
|
|
|
ul {
|
|
margin: 0;
|
|
padding: 0;
|
|
|
|
li {
|
|
padding: 10px;
|
|
list-style: none;
|
|
|
|
&:not(:last-child) {
|
|
border-bottom: 1px solid #eaeaea;
|
|
}
|
|
|
|
.octicon,
|
|
.fa {
|
|
margin-left: 1px;
|
|
margin-right: 5px;
|
|
}
|
|
|
|
&.follow {
|
|
.ui.button {
|
|
width: 100%;
|
|
}
|
|
}
|
|
}
|
|
}
|
|
}
|
|
|
|
#profile-avatar {
|
|
@media only screen and (max-width: 768px) {
|
|
height: 250px;
|
|
overflow: hidden;
|
|
|
|
img {
|
|
max-height: 768px;
|
|
max-width: 768px;
|
|
}
|
|
}
|
|
}
|
|
|
|
@media only screen and (max-width: 768px) {
|
|
width: 100%;
|
|
}
|
|
}
|
|
|
|
.ui.repository.list {
|
|
margin-top: 25px;
|
|
}
|
|
|
|
#loading-heatmap {
|
|
margin-bottom: 1em;
|
|
}
|
|
}
|
|
|
|
&.followers {
|
|
.header.name {
|
|
font-size: 20px;
|
|
line-height: 24px;
|
|
vertical-align: middle;
|
|
}
|
|
|
|
.follow {
|
|
.ui.button {
|
|
padding: 8px 15px;
|
|
}
|
|
}
|
|
}
|
|
|
|
&.notification {
|
|
.octicon {
|
|
float: left;
|
|
font-size: 2em;
|
|
|
|
&.green {
|
|
color: #21ba45;
|
|
}
|
|
|
|
&.red {
|
|
color: #d01919;
|
|
}
|
|
|
|
&.purple {
|
|
color: #a333c8;
|
|
}
|
|
|
|
&.blue {
|
|
color: #2185d0;
|
|
}
|
|
}
|
|
|
|
.content {
|
|
float: left;
|
|
margin-left: 7px;
|
|
}
|
|
|
|
table {
|
|
form {
|
|
display: inline-block;
|
|
}
|
|
|
|
button {
|
|
padding: 3px 3px 3px 5px;
|
|
}
|
|
|
|
tr {
|
|
cursor: pointer;
|
|
}
|
|
}
|
|
}
|
|
|
|
&.link-account:not(.icon) {
|
|
padding-top: 15px;
|
|
padding-bottom: 5px;
|
|
}
|
|
|
|
&.settings {
|
|
.iconFloat {
|
|
float: left;
|
|
}
|
|
}
|
|
}
|
|
|
|
.user-orgs {
|
|
display: flex;
|
|
flex-flow: row wrap;
|
|
padding: 0;
|
|
margin: -3px !important;
|
|
|
|
li {
|
|
display: flex;
|
|
border-bottom: 0 !important;
|
|
padding: 3px !important;
|
|
width: 20%;
|
|
max-width: 60px;
|
|
}
|
|
}
|